> Web Authorization Protocol (oauth)
>
> Description of Working Group
>
> The Web Authorization (OAuth) protocol allows a user to grant
> a third-party Web site or application access to the user's protected
> resources, without necessarily revealing their long-term credentials,
> or even their identity. For example, a photo-sharing site that supports
> OAuth could allow its users to use a third-party printing Web site to
> print their private pictures, without allowing the printing site to
> gain full control of the user's account and without having the user
> sharing his or her photo-sharing sites' long-term credential with the
> printing site.
>
> The OAuth protocol suite encompasses
> * a procedure for allowing a client to discover a resource server,
> * a protocol for obtaining authorization tokens from an authorization
> server with the resource owner's consent,
> * protocols for presenting these authorization tokens to protected
> resources for access to a resource, and
> * consequently for sharing data in a security and privacy respective way.
>
> In April 2010 the OAuth 1.0 specification, documenting pre-IETF work,
> was published as an informational document (RFC 5849). With the
> completion of OAuth 1.0 the working group started their work on OAuth 2.0
> to incorporate implementation experience with version 1.0, additional
> use cases, and various other security, readability, and interoperability
> improvements. An extensive security analysis was conducted and the result
> is available as a stand-alone document offering guidance for audiences
> beyond the community of protocol implementers.
>
> The working group also developed security schemes for presenting authorization
> tokens to access a protected resource. This led to the publication of
> the bearer token as well as the message authentication code (MAC) access
> authentication specification.
>
> OAuth 2.0 added the ability to trade a SAML assertion against an OAUTH token with
> the SAML 2.0 bearer assertion profile.  This offers interworking with existing
> identity management solutions, in particular SAML based deployments.
>
> OAuth has enjoyed widespread adoption by the Internet application service provider
> community. To build on this success we aim for nothing more than to make OAuth the
> authorization framework of choice for any Internet protocol. Consequently, the
> ongoing standardization effort within the OAuth working group is focused on
> enhancing interoperability of OAuth deployments. While the core OAuth specification
> truly is an important building block it relies on other specifications in order to
> claim completeness. Luckily, these components already exist and have been deployed
> on the Internet. Through the IETF standards process they will be improved in
> quality and will undergo a rigorous review process.
